Salary History Ban: Gender Pay Gap and Spillover Effects

TL;DR: In this article, the authors study the effect of the US salary history ban which restricts employers from inquiring about applicants' pay history during the hiring process and find that the bans reduce gender pay gap by 4.2% points in hourly wages.
